What is kiloparsec (Kpc)

A kiloparsec (kpc) is a unit of measurement used in astrophysics and astronomy to describe distances on cosmic scales. It is equal to one thousand parsecs. A parsec (pc) is a unit of length used in astronomy to express large distances, and it is approximately equal to 3.09 × 10^16 meters or 3.09 × 10^13 kilometers.

So, a kiloparsec is equivalent to:

1 kiloparsec (kpc) = 1,000 parsecs (pc)

Kiloparsecs are often used to describe distances within galaxies, particularly when discussing the size of a galaxy or the scale of its components. For example, the size of a galaxy's disk or the distance between star clusters within a galaxy might be expressed in kiloparsecs. Additionally, kiloparsecs are used to measure the separation between galaxies in galaxy clusters and superclusters. Since astronomical distances can be extremely large, the parsec and its multiples provide a convenient way to express these distances in a more manageable manner.

What is Earth's polar radius

Earth's polar radius, often denoted as "r," is the distance from the center of the Earth to a point on the Earth's surface near either the North Pole or the South Pole. It represents the Earth's radius when measured from its center to a point along its polar axis. The polar radius is shorter than the equatorial radius because the Earth is slightly flattened at the poles and bulges at the equator due to its rotation.

The approximate value for Earth's polar radius is about 6,357 kilometers (or approximately 3,949 miles). This value may vary slightly depending on the reference ellipsoid used for modeling the Earth's shape, but the given value is a commonly used and accurate approximation for most purposes.

In contrast to the polar radius, Earth's equatorial radius (measured from the center to a point on the equator) is slightly longer, approximately 6,378.1 kilometers (3,963.2 miles).
